// Fixture: deploy-status chat bot (Quibberly project).
// This block seeds the mock conversation state used by the
// StatusBot handler tests. Each message simulates a user in the
// #releases channel asking whether the Harbormaster pipeline
// finished. Note that the bot replies are matched verbatim, so
// any wording change in responses.go must be mirrored here.
// The fixture authenticates against the staging chat gateway,
// which requires a bearer token; the one used by CI is below.

portal login ticket: eyJhbGciOiJIUzI1NiIsInR5cCI6IkpXVCJ9.eyJzdWIiOiIMjvRAf3PEFIn0.nuv9gjixLtnr

Ticket: Config drift on Gullwing crash-report pipeline

The ingest workers in the secondary region are running different sampling and retention values than the primary, so support dashboards show mismatched crash counts for the Gullwing mobile app. No data loss, just inconsistent reporting. Ops will reconcile during the next maintenance window. For comparison, the intended baseline configuration is recorded below.

deployment values, bahof-badug:
[rusix]
team = zorok
access_code = ac_641cbe
owner = ulair.tamius
host = rusix.torvasoft.local
port = 5672
peer = ulaix.sivrelworks.internal
salt = 1df570ed
pin = 6327

## Service Accounts — Spoketide Rebalancer

Spoketide moves dock inventory between stations overnight. It runs under a dedicated service account, not personal creds. Scope: read station telemetry, write rebalance plans, nothing else. Don't widen it. New team members: never run the rebalancer locally against prod with your own login; use the staging account. Rotation is quarterly, owned by the platform crew in Fernhollow. The account authenticates to the dispatch API with the key shown directly below.

API key for yahig-tadup: kto7_ubizbYm

Ticket #4471 — EXIF scrubber skips rotated thumbnails

Component: PixelRinse scrub pipeline

External plugin authors reported that images processed through the rotation plugin retain GPS tags in the embedded thumbnail. The main image is scrubbed correctly; only the thumbnail block survives. Root cause appears to be the scrubber running before plugin transforms re-embed metadata. Workaround: call the scrub hook as the final stage. A fix reorders the pipeline so scrubbing always runs last. Affected builds are identified by the trace token below.

trace token, fafog-kageg: htk4_98e6